+/// The enum of states that [TransformNode] can be in.
+class _TransformNodeState {
+ /// The transform node is running [Transformer.isPrimary] or
+ /// [Transformer.apply] and doesn't need to re-run them.
+ ///
+ /// If there are no external changes by the time the processing finishes, this
+ /// will transition to [APPLIED] or [NOT_PRIMARY] depending on the result of
+ /// [Transformer.isPrimary]. If the primary input changes, this will
+ /// transition to [NEEDS_IS_PRIMARY]. If a secondary input changes, this will
+ /// transition to [NEEDS_APPLY].
+ static final PROCESSING = const _TransformNodeState._("processing");
+
+ /// The transform is running [Transformer.isPrimary] or [Transformer.apply],
+ /// but since it started the primary input changed, so it will need to re-run
+ /// [Transformer.isPrimary].
+ ///
+ /// This will always transition to [Transformer.PROCESSING].
+ static final NEEDS_IS_PRIMARY =
+ const _TransformNodeState._("needs isPrimary");
+
+ /// The transform is running [Transformer.apply], but since it started a
+ /// secondary input changed, so it will need to re-run [Transformer.apply].
+ ///
+ /// If there are no external changes by the time [Transformer.apply] finishes,
+ /// this will transition to [PROCESSING]. If the primary input changes, this
+ /// will transition to [NEEDS_IS_PRIMARY].
+ static final NEEDS_APPLY = const _TransformNodeState._("needs apply");
+
+ /// The transform has finished running [Transformer.apply], whether or not it
+ /// emitted an error.
+ ///
+ /// If the primary input or a secondary input changes, this will transition to
+ /// [PROCESSING].
+ static final APPLIED = const _TransformNodeState._("applied");
+
+ /// The transform has finished running [Transformer.isPrimary], which returned
+ /// `false`.
+ ///
+ /// If the primary input changes, this will transition to [PROCESSING].
+ static final NOT_PRIMARY = const _TransformNodeState._("not primary");
+
